chib

English

Alternative forms

* chiv, shiv, shive

Noun

(en noun)
  • (Scotland, Geordie, slang) A shiv (makeshift knife).
  • Verb

  • (Scotland, Geordie, slang) To shiv (stab).
  • * 2008 , (James Kelman), Kieron Smith, Boy , Penguin 2009, p. 61:
  • And if they had knives too, their gang had all knives and people were going to get chibbed .
